      Just watched this a few days ago and it’s still very accurate.

      Buddy Christ the marketing gimmick to get people interested in religion, the board room scene with every person running the company is piece of shit, black people getting written out of history with Chris Rock being unknown as 13th apostle, it raises the question of loopholes and how verbatim is religion meant to be taken and it talked about how beliefs can be manipulated but you can’t kill an Idea.

      Overall it’s probably Kevin Smiths best written work.

      It turns a mirror to religion to self reflect without outright attacking religion, which you need to convince people of new ideas.
